Amend Bill, page 4, by inserting between lines 10 and 11
(o) Financial responsibility.--A city of the second class
shall require financial responsibility for a commercial electric
scooter enterprise as follows:
(1) A commercial electric scooter enterprise shall
maintain the following insurance that is in effect for the
duration of the micro-mobility pilot project:
(i) commercial general liability insurance coverage
with a limit of at least $2,000,000 each occurrence and
$2,000,000 aggregate;
(ii) automobile insurance coverage with a limit of
at least $1,000,000 each occurrence and $1,000,000

aggregate; and
(iii) when the scooter-share operator employs an
individual, workers' compensation coverage of no less
than required by law.
(2) A commercial electric scooter enterprise shall
provide proof of insurance coverage to the city of the second
class to satisfy the requirements of this subsection.
(3) In addition to any fines that may be imposed, a city
of the second class may impose a civil penalty on a
commercial electric scooter enterprise that does not provide
the insurance required under this subsection in an amount not
to exceed $1,000 per day the commercial electric scooter
enterprise is operated without providing the required
insurance. A civil penalty collected under this paragraph by
a city of the second class shall be used for the safety,
operation and management of electric low-speed scooters or
pedalcycles.
